About Deaf & Hearing Impaired Services Inc
DHIS, Inc. is committed to providing the highest quality of comprehensive services for Deaf and hard of hearing older adults and their families, in southeast Michigan, linking their talents to the Deaf youth population through mentoring programs that enhance language and living skills, while promoting their independence and dignity through cooperative efforts with other community-based service pro

What Is the Cost of Living Near Farmington?

Understanding the cost of living near Farmington is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Deaf & Hearing Impaired Services Inc.
Farmington/Farmington Hills (Oakland Co.) Cost of Living Index is approx. 102-105. Affluent Detroit suburbs, good schools, housing near/above US avg. SMART bus. When planning your budget based on a salary from Deaf & Hearing Impaired Services Inc,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,200 - $1,700+ A significant portion of Deaf & Hearing Impaired Services Inc sal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$150 - $240 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$70 (SMART monthly p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$400 - $590 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$380 - $680+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$380 - $700+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$2,580 - $3,910+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
